[QUOTE="TheLBLman, post: 4361993, member: 1409"] [i]FOR THE MONEY,[/i] this particular Sig is likely the best value going. Really decent glass in it, feature rich. I bought one a couple weeks ago to give to a friend for Christmas, and may get one for myself just for archery hunting. Unlike many others, this one is 4x magnification instead of 6x or higher. Far as I'm concerned, less magnification is an advantage for bowhunting, and 4x is plenty out to 4 or 5 hundred yards.
